  2. The G18 being crossflow has a more balanced look to the engine bay. The L18 isnt a crossflow and I might have a tight drivers side in the engine bay as its a LHD with the clutch master cyl. and brakes master and servo taking up some space already. My 4 speed trans. Should fit the L18 bolt on, turns out its also used in the 620, came with a L18 and the same 4 speed. Thanks DatzenMike

My original engine will not last, not sounding too good, and I know I will not be able to a complete rebuild as not all parts are a available, I need a complete cylinder head and its a rare thing to find for a G18. I would love to keep it but it will get a propper rebuild in a later stage. Question: Would I need to modify anything on the engine mounts if I plane to swap my G18 for a L18 ? Im trying to find an engine that would fit bolt on with the least mods possible. I know for a fact that the engine mounts are different on the G18 than a L18, different number of studs.   8. Hello Datworld, Glad to find a place with pure Datsun-heads. I just got my first Datsun. Not my first Jap though, have a 1975 Landcruiser FJ43 since 2010. My C110 has good potential but I still did not decide on what I plan and direction I plan to take. I has its original L18 engine 4 speed manual. Latest owner had some much electronics added which I plan to remove in plan to return the car to its original appearance and aesthetics. Non orignal mirrors, missing chrome parts, non original seats (original ones are with me but need to be redone) and lots more.. I would say the 180K is 75% complete, has some rust and needs a restoration. I plan to use it as a daily drive, I prefer naturally aspirated and a twin carb conversion is something on my list. I also plan to make a roll bar inside, strengthen suspension mounting points, make some sump and under-carriage protection...etc. and rally it from time to time. Knowing Egyptian streets are full of pot holes and bumps it would help to have narrower tires and preferably raise it an inch... Rally seats and normal driving seats would be a bolt on swap matter. Current wheels are 15" Borbet look-alikes (width, 7" front & 8" rear) I would love to know what were the sizes of the original rims? 14"? 13"? I would return it to original for better suspension geometry and nippy handling, also less harmful to suspension and steering parts.
